For those who can't see it in the small picture, the lever appears to be the standard one used for the rear SVC. A different view of the lever located at the right-front corner of the seat. You can see the 3PH lift lever just slightly above & behind the 3rd SVC lever.

As for capping the lines, Deere should sell the rubber plugs as seen in this picture
